What Changes Have We Noticed Over the Years?
Looking back at Hathaway's beauty evolution, it's vital to understand the natural aging process. Initially noted for her strong cheekbone structure, low hairline, and well-defined lips, Hathaway’s features would have naturally evolved over time. Reports suggest that since 2018, Hathaway began using Botox, likely sparking a shift in public interest regarding non-invasive cosmetic procedures.
By 2023, she exhibited slight signs of aging, such as minimal brow ptosis and eyelid hooding, indicating common age-related changes. Many may ponder whether these appearances hint at cosmetic work or are merely signs of aging— a reality we all face.

Choosing the Right Treatment: What Should You Consider?
Hathaway stands as a prominent figure who illustrates the need for personalized decisions regarding cosmetic issues. It’s crucial to evaluate your facial characteristics, desired outcomes, and budget before making choices.
Cosmetic surgery is not a one-size-fits-all answer. Some find success in addressing upper face aging separately from the lower face and neck. This nuanced approach often leads to more satisfactory results tailored to individual needs.
